Hyperbolic segmented outer plate jig and design method thereof

By designing a hyperbolic segmented outer panel frame and utilizing a combination of pillars and support templates, the problems of large mold size and high processing difficulty were solved, thereby improving material costs and processing efficiency.

AI Technical Summary

Technical Problem

Among the existing hyperbolic segmented outer panel jigs, the conforming template is relatively long, has high material costs, and is difficult to process and install.

Method used

Design a hyperbolic segmented outer panel jig, including multiple pillars and support templates. The top of the pillars is used to directly support or connect the support templates. The support templates are attached to the second curved outer panel. The first curved outer panel is relatively flat and has a low curvature, so it only needs to be supported by pillars, which reduces the size and processing difficulty of the support templates.

Benefits of technology

It effectively reduced the size and processing and installation difficulty of the support template, reduced material costs, and improved support stability and processing efficiency.

Abstract

The present application belongs to the technical field of double-curved segmented outer plate processing, and discloses a double-curved segmented outer plate jig and a design method thereof. The double-curved segmented outer plate jig comprises a plurality of support columns arranged on the ground, and a plurality of support templates. The top of part of the support columns is used for directly supporting the double-curved segmented outer plate, and the top of another part of the support columns is used for connecting the support templates. The support templates are used for supporting the second curved outer plate, and the top surface of the support templates can be attached to the surface of the second curved outer plate, thereby providing stable support for the second curved outer plate. In addition, since the first curved outer plate is relatively flat as a whole and has a low curvature, the first curved outer plate only needs to be supported by the support columns, and does not need to be supported by the support templates. The size of the support templates can be effectively reduced, and when the support templates are processed, only the curved shape of the second curved outer plate needs to be considered, thereby greatly reducing the processing and installation difficulty.
